Power Supply

Requirements

Availability

Before installing the machine, consider the availability and proximity of the required power supply circuit. If an existing circuit does not meet the requirements for this machine, a new circuit must be installed.

To minimize the risk of electrocution, fire, or equipment damage, installation work and electrical wiring must be done by an electrician or qualified service personnel in accordance with all applicable codes.

Serious injury could occur if you connect the machine to power before completing the setup process. DO NOT connect to power until instructed later in this manual.

Full-Load Current Rating

The full-load current rating is the amperage a machine draws at 100% of the rated output power. On machines with multiple motors, this is the amperage drawn by the largest motor or sum of all motors and electrical devices that might operate at one time during normal operations.

SB1046PF Full-Load Rating

19.23 Amps

SB1047PF Full-Load Rating

19.23 Amps

SB1048PF Full-Load Rating

19.23 Amps

SB1056F Full-Load Rating

19.23 Amps

SB1057F Full-Load Rating

19.23 Amps

SB1058F Full-Load Rating

19.23 Amps

For your own safety and protection of property, consult an electrician if you are unsure about wiring practices or applicable electrical codes.

The full-load current is not the maximum amount of amps that the machine will draw. If the machine is overloaded, it will draw additional amps beyond the full-load rating.

If the machine is overloaded for a sufficient length of time, damage, overheating, or fire may result—especially if connected to an undersized circuit. To reduce the risk of these hazards, avoid overloading the machine during operation and make sure it is connected to a power supply circuit that meets the requirements in the following section.

Circuit Requirements

This machine is prewired to operate on a 440V power supply circuit that has a verified ground and meets the following requirements:

Nominal Voltage

440V/480V

Cycle

60 Hz

Phase

3-Phase

Circuit Rating

30 Amps

Connection... Hardwire with Locking Switch

A power supply circuit includes all electrical equipment between the main breaker box or fuse panel in your building and the incoming power connections inside the machine. Note: The circuit requirements in this manual are for a dedicated circuit—where only one machine will be running at a time. If this machine will be connected to a shared circuit where multiple machines will be running at the same time, consult a qualified electrician to ensure the circuit is properly sized.
